St. Henry and Holy Cross are an even 5-5 against one another since January of 2019, but not for long. The St. Henry Crusaders will be playing in front of their home fans against the Holy Cross Indians at 7:00 p.m. on Thursday.

Last Tuesday, St. Henry came up short against Campbell County and fell 56-48. The Crusaders haven't had much luck with the Camels recently, as the team has come up short the last four times they've met.

Meanwhile, Holy Cross posted their biggest win since January 9th on Tuesday. They simply couldn't be stopped as they easily beat Cincinnati 64-34. Given the Indians' advantage in MaxPreps' basketball rankings in their respective home states (they are ranked 52nd in Kentucky, while the Eagles are ranked 644th in Ohio), the result wasn't entirely unexpected.

The victory made it two in a row for Holy Cross and bumps their season record up to 15-10. Those victories came thanks in part to their offensive performance across that stretch, as they averaged 69.5 points over those games. As for St. Henry, their loss dropped their record down to 7-17.

St. Henry came up short against Holy Cross when the teams last played back in February of 2024, falling 56-52. Will St. Henry have more luck at home instead of on the road? Check MaxPreps after the action for a full breakdown of the game and more basketball content.
